Headline Roundup May 16th, 2018

President Trump Officially Discloses Reimbursing Michael Cohen for Stormy Daniels Payment

Summary from the AllSides News Team

In a recently filed financial disclosure, President Trump has officially confirmed reimbursing his lawyer Michael Cohen for the $130,000 hush-money payment made to Stormy Daniels over an alleged extramarital affair.
